What is Apollo Ingredients GF Score?

Apollo Ingredients BOM:503639 +1.99% 27 GF Score is 27 as of Aug. 06, 2026, which is 43% below its 10-year median of 47.00. GuruFocus rates BOM:503639 with a GF Score™ of 27/100. The stock has 5 warning signs investors should review.

Apollo Ingredients has the GF Score of 27, which implies that the company might have Worst future performance potential, or not enough data.

The GF Score is a stock performance ranking system developed by GuruFocus using five aspects of valuation, which has been found to be closely correlated to the long-term performances of stocks by backtesting from 2006 to 2021. The stocks with a higher GF Score generally generate higher returns than those with lower GF Scores. Therefore, when picking stocks, investors should invest in companies with high GF Scores. The GF Score ranges from 0 to 100, with 100 as the highest rank.

GF Score takes following five key aspects into consideration:

1. Financial Strength : 10/10
2. Profitability Rank : 4/10
3. Growth Rank : 0/10
4. GF Value Rank : 2/10
5. Momentum Rank : 1/10

Each one of these components is ranked and the ranks also have positive correlation with the long term performances of stocks. The GF score is calculated using the five key aspects of analysis. Through backtesting, we know that each of these key aspects has a different impact on the stock price performance. Thus, they are weighted differently when calculating the total score. The Profitability Rank and the Growth Rank are weighted fully, while other parameters have less weight.

Apollo Ingredients  (BOM:503639) GF Score Explanation

Based on the historical long-term performances among five valuation aspects, the GF Score is found to be closely correlated to the long-term performances of stocks. It ranges from 0 to 100, with 100 as the highest. GuruFocus divided GF Score into following 5 categories:

GF Score Performance Potential and All-in-One Screener Examples (1)
91 - 100Highest outperformance potential
81 - 90Good outperformance potential
71 - 80Likely to have average performance
51 - 70Poor future performance potential
0 - 50Worst future performance potential, or not enough data

Apollo Ingredients Business Description

Address Sector 2, A-1, Nalandapushp Cooperative Housing Society, Naigaon, East Thane, Thane, MH, IND, 401201
Apollo Ingredients Ltd is engaged in extracting oil by crushing, by chemical, or any other process from soya bean, copra, mustard seed, till seed, cotton seed, linseed, castor-seed, groundnuts, or other nut or seed, other oil-bearing seed, substance and in the business of manufacturers and dealers of all kinds of oils, oil seeds and oil products and the cultivation of oil seeds.
